M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
examines
topics
regarding open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Recent
improvements in
blended learning are providing the means for
people
all over the world
to be participants in online classes.
Massive open online courses are
almost always free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
topics that
online education institutions
have to consider
now that distance learning technology is
improving so rapidly.
How can organizations
assure that
the quality of instruction provided by these
MOOC classes is
good?
How can we
make sure that
lecturers are properly credentialed
and qualified for online teaching?
What different strategies are being used by
institutions like
Stanford University to conduct these MOOC classes?
What innovative teaching practices and assessment strategies are optimal?
How can teachers
get a handle on
inadequate
learner motivation and high
dropout rates?
